Wimbledon is heading towards the business end of the tournament as the quarter-finals get underway on Tuesday with Novak Djokovic and Iga Swiatek among the big names hoping to book their places in the last four. Djokovic only finished his four-set victory over Herbert Hurkacz on Monday evening but the Serbian is back in action again, with Swiatek ready to face the Ukrainian Elina Svitolina in a feisty clash.

Seven-time SW19 champion Djokovic had to battle past Hurkacz after the curfew denied him the chance to finish off his match on Sunday and after a minor blip, the 36-year-old emerged unscathed. He now faces the Russian Andrey Rublev, a player the Serbian has praised highly after admitting he was not at his best level in his previous match.

Swiatek will be the favourite to overwhelm Svitolina but the Ukrainian star – into her second Grand Slam quarter-final since the birth of her daughter – has several outside factors motivating her towards pulling off a shock victory.

However, her pleas over an announcement for Wimbledon umpires to make it clear that she will not shake hands of Russian or Belarusian opponents have fallen on deaf ears.

  • McEnroe told off by BBC host

    BBC Wimbledon host Clare Balding had to remind John McEnroe what channel he’s on after his comment made live on TV.

    As Ons Jabeur walked out on to Centre Court, Balding said: “Jabeur is looking up at the sky above wondering if it’s going to rain. I think the answer is no. But it is overcast. It’s one of those days that would see a bit of swing on the ball in cricket.”

    Tim Henman then added: “Yep definitely. Good conditions for the seamers!”

    Before McEnroe chimed in: “Are the swingers the ones who don’t throw it as hard? Is that what swingers are? We have different definitions in the States!”

    McEnroe’s comment had Tracy Austin bursting with laughter but Balding said: “We’re talking about something completely different John! It’s not a channel for that sort of talk.”
